#3. Devin Haney announces two-year break from boxing

Devin Haney has shocked boxing fans after announcing his plans to take a two-year hiatus from the ring.

In his last outing, Haney took on Ryan Garcia in a highly anticipated clash in April. What was expected to be a routine victory for 'The Dream' proved anything but, as Garcia put on the best performance of his career, dropping Haney three times on his way to a majority decision victory.

Controversy then stemmed following the fight, after it was reported Garcia had tested positive for a banned substance. He has since denied the accusations and stated his willingness to subject himself to further testing.

With Garcia's future up in the air and a potential ban looming, Haney took to X to announce his decision to step away from boxing until he can face 'KingRy' in a rematch. He wrote:

"I'ma take some time.. spend some of my money.. travel the world & I’ll be back in two years after Ryan's [Garcia] suspension & we can fight again."

#2. UFC star Conor McGregor places huge bet on Cristiano Ronaldo to win Golden Boot at UEFA Euro 2024

Conor McGregor has backed footballing icon Critstiano Ronaldo to retain the Golden Boot he previously won at Euro 2020.

The Irishman and 'CR7' have struck up a friendship over recent years following Ronaldo's move to Saudi Arabian club, Al-Nassr FC. The pair have been pictured at some of the biggest sporting events held in the country, including the Tyson Fury-Francis Ngannou bout last year.

Taking to X to announce his wager, the UFC star revealed he had placed a whopping $60,000 on the Portuguese marksman to top the scoring charts at this year's Euro.

"60 G’s on @Cristiano to retain his Euro Golden Boot. Siuuu!"

#1. Joe Rogan praises British crime dramas such as Peaky Blinders and Gentlemen

On the latest episode of The Joe Rogan Experience (JRE), Joe Rogan couldn't contain his praise for the latest crime dramas he has been binging.

On episode #2165 of his podcast, the UFC commentator was speaking with guest Jack Carr and revealed he had just started watching the critically acclaimed British crime drama 'Peaky Blinders.'

Rogan then admitted that he had started watching the show after first binging through the entirety of Guy Ritchie's new Netflix show 'The Gentlemen.' He said:

"I just started watching Peaky Blinders. F**king great! It's f**king great! I burned through The Gentlemen, which is Guy Ritchie's new show on Netflix, which is amazing. It's f**ing great! Prime Guy Ritchie. It's great."

The UFC color commentator continued:

"And then, a lot of friends have been telling me, 'You got to watch Peaky Blinders,' and Jamie keeps telling me I got to watch The Wire, and that's next. The Wire's next, but I got to get through Peaky Blinders. Peaky Blinders is fu*ing great."
